On test: Apple MacBook Pro (10/2008)
The most recent update to Apple's high-end notebook line has been more about refining the design and increasing productivity rather than adding in a raft of new features or significantly ramping up processor speed. However, one aspect of the refresh will be of special interest to gamers as the new system now comes with an implementation of Nvidia's Hybrid SLI technology.
